# The following machinery tests the game against a binary made from
# the advent430 branch To use it, switch to that branch, build the
# binary, run it once to generate adventure.data, then switch back to
# master leaving advent430 and adventure.data in place (make clean
# does not remove them).
#
# make clean # Clean up object files, laving a bare source tree
# git checkout advent430 # Check out the advent430 branch
# make # Build the advent430 binary
# advent430 # Run it. Answer the novice question and quit
# make clean # Remove .o files
# git checkout master # Go back to master branch
# make # Rebuild advent.
#
# The diff file produced has corrected spellings in it. That's what oldfilter
# is for, to massage out the original spellings and avoid noise diffs.
# Diffs in amount of whitespace and trailing whitespace are ignored
#
# A magic comment of NOCOMPARE in a log file excludes it from this comparison.
# making it a skipped test in the TAP view. First use of this was to avoid a
# spurious mismatch on the news text. Other uses avoid spurious mismatches due
# to bug fixes.
#
# When adding more tests, bear in mind that any game that continues after a
# resurrection will need a NOCOMPARE. At some point in the forward port,
# resurrection was accidentally changed in a way that messed with the LCG chain.
#
# The *.chk files need not be up-to-date for this to work.
#
